A big survey in China of 677 medical staff showed that most supported AI triage. Almost half said they liked using only AI for this task. People who had used AI before were more positive about it. Also, learning about AI through media made staff see it as more valuable.<\/p>\n<p><\/p>\n<p>In the U.S., healthcare workers may worry about AI accuracy and ethics. Wrong or missing information makes AI less reliable.<\/li>\n<li><strong>Algorithmic Bias<\/strong>: AI can copy biases found in its training data, which may cause unfair treatment. This means AI must be checked and improved often.<\/li>\n<li><strong>Clinician Trust and Ethical Concerns<\/strong>: Some medical staff might not fully trust AI unless there are clear rules about how to handle AI mistakes and who is responsible.<\/li>\n<li><strong>Integration Complexity<\/strong>: Adding AI to existing hospital systems and records takes time, money, and planning.<\/li>\n<\/ul>\n<p><\/p>\n<p>Even with these challenges, training and clear ethical rules can help solve many problems.<\/p>\n<p><\/p>\n<h2>AI and Workflow Automation in Emergency Departments<\/h2>\n<p>AI can also help in other parts of emergency care beyond triage.
